i just got my young beardie a few months ago! one thing to know is that they LOVE to climb and observe from high places, at least mine does! they also need uvb, the one i have is arcadia 12%, if you could, i would put it inside the tank because the mesh top blocks a lot of the uvb. i also have their halogen 100w. i got my enclosure from dubia.com (i also get their dubia roaches for my little guy too), and it's been holding up for a few years! the set up was a little annoying but it's just a bit of hammering. I also buy from biodude.com and he sells a ton of bioactive plants, kits, and soil, i bought an elephant feed plant that my beardie likes to nibble on and their dragon 120gallon kit, which helped so much in creating my enclosure. i wish you good luck on your research! i have experience with a couple different reptiles and their care, so if you have any questions feel free to ask!
